Restoration of the integrity of myelin sheaths would likely result in a slowing or stopping of the progression of:

<span>Multiple sclerosis would likely be slowed if the myelin sheaths were restored. This disease is manifest by a degradation of the sheaths along the neuronal bodies, which leads to a delayed (or diminished) ability for a person to carry a signal along these neurons, and a diminished capacity for movement.</span>
